Robert Mugabe flown to Singapore for treatment

President Robert Mugabe

Zimbabwe's 93-year-old, President Robert Mugabe has been flown to Singapore for a "routine medical check-up". The world's oldest ruler, who has appeared increasingly frail in public, addressed delegates at a World Economic Forum meeting in South Africa last week in what AFP news agency described as a "slurred tone while slumped in his seat".

Mr Mugabe is expected back home in time for Saturday's funeral of former chief justice Godfrey Chidyausiku, the Herald reports. Vice-President Emmerson Mnangagwa is performing his duties in his absence.
